Output 6246831c0eb06d873ccfe43adf4c36ac28b34b180674ca52dfc26651a3a13b79:1

value
17500000
script pubkey
OP_0 OP_PUSHBYTES_20 6da3575cf6ab5df52880a00b65b3f4fe0ce2fefb
address
bc1qdk34wh8k4dwl22yq5q9ktvl5lcxw9lhmzkyfzq
transaction
6246831c0eb06d873ccfe43adf4c36ac28b34b180674ca52dfc26651a3a13b79